What legal setup do I need beyond incorporation (IP, contracts, compliance)?

Assign all IP to the company from every founder and contractor in writing, use clean contractor and employment agreements, and stay on top of statutory filings (annual returns, taxes, ROC/state compliance). Missing IP assignment or 83(b)/ESOP paperwork is what actually blows up due diligence later. Get the boring hygiene right early, it's cheap now and expensive to fix during a raise.
